One of the reasons behind Papadum’s popularity is that it is one ingredient that could be consumed in so many ways and comes in so many varieties. Roasted, deep fried, masala, chilli, pepper and a hundred more varieties. It is an inseparable part of Indian meals as it is light, crispy, and leaves your taste buds delighted with their crunch. 

These Papadums are easy to consume and are among the the easiest-to-cook food items. You can cook them in ways as easy as:

Microwave/Oven:
Place the Papadums in the microwave or in the oven on microwave safe plate and cook for about 60 - 90 seconds until crispy. Serve hot with the dressing of your choice.

Stovetop/Grill:
Place the Papadums in a pan on stovetop or on a grill and cook on high for about 1 minute until crispy. Serve hot with the dressing of your choice.

Veggie-Loaded Papadums Recipe:

Just add some finely chopped veggies like tomatoes, onions, capsicum, cucumber and even boiled corn kernels. Mix them up with our Chat Masala, and garnish it all over the Papadum. Masala Papadum has all the potential to be your next favorite snack to crunch on!

Cottage Cheese and Papadum Fritters:

Another recipe that completes your search for a delicious, yet crunchy snack is this one.

  1. First, roast or microwave a Papadum like the previous recipe; crush it, and keep it aside.
  2. Then, get some cottage cheese, crumble it, and add some of our Himalayan Black Salt and Garlic Powder to it.
  3. After that, mix two to three teaspoons of tomato ketchup in it, and form little balls of the mixture.
  4. In another cup, take some all-purpose flour and put about half a glass of water into it; mix it well.
  5. Dip the cheese balls into the flour-water paste and roll them into the crushed Papadum.
  6. Bake them in an oven until they turn golden brown from all the sides.

When done take them out, and serve piping hot with any dip you desire.
